Here are the steps for routing the SMTP Outgoing mail through Gmail:

  • First and foremost, go to your client e software for the account which is been worked upon (eg. outlook). Type smtp.gmail.com in the SMTP server box.

  • In the username field, type your Gmail id username. It must be noted that Gmail requires the username as well as the password for the same account. In case the default account is other than the Gmail account than type the username and password of that particular account.

  • Finally, check for the TLS as the secure connection.
